Saigon Jewellery helps revamp ITCWednesday, 15th December 2004 (3163 views) The Saigon Jewellery Company (SJC) has announced that it is to help give the Saigon International Trade Centre (ITC) a new look, following it burning down in a fire in October 2002.The centre will be the site for the country's largest gold trading centre, according to Fibre to Fashion. Previously the ITC was a jewellery and precious stone trading centre in the city. The project will cost $50 million and includes a basement, 8,000 sq m trading floor, apartments and hotel rooms. Two 40 storey twin towers will be erected at the site, situated in HCM City's District 1.
